where have you gone? O���Connor, right, stands with Sir Edmund Hillary during his first trip to the foothills of Mt. Everest in the spring of 1973. He would return each spring for nearly 40 years to help build schools and hospitals. photo courtesy OF THE SIR EDMUND HILLARY FOUNDATION In Nepal, everyone knew O���Connor and Hillary. They visited every spring with almost no exceptions for 40 years. They helped the sherpas build the area���s first hospital and children���s hospital, and then helped staff them for decades. They added 13 medical clinics in more remote villages, along with schools, bridges and other projects that the community elders proposed.
